Giles goatboy takes place in an allegorical alternate world in which the whole of earth is a single university, with colleges instead of countries, chancellors and deans instead of presidents and kings, and grand tutors instead of religious leaders. The novels protagonist, billy bockfuss also called george giles, the goatboy, was raised with herds of goats on a university farm after being found as a baby in the bowels of the giant west campus automatic computer wescac.

It is metafictional comic novel in which the universe is portrayed as a university campus in an elaborate allegory of both the heros journey and the cold war. Giles, a boy raised as a goat, discovers his humanity and becomes a savior in a story presented as a computer tape given to barth, who denied that it was his work.
